Output 330bda62fa67592289b6817075ee12914a374a4fb076de933142b4b511b589bc:2

value
1050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b105bba34f9c5bcf3d43aa1457f6c908f20bf01 OP_EQUALVERIFY OP_CHECKSIG
address
17quGyzRvHQBxwGZe7LqwkokXitKDvMDLF
transaction
330bda62fa67592289b6817075ee12914a374a4fb076de933142b4b511b589bc
spent
true